    Yeah, I'm probably on the same page as Nick here.

    Honestly, what's helped me is remembering my parts are analogious to a cisman's. Clit = mini penis, etc. How you think/refer to them makes a huge difference. Don't think of your body as a woman's body but instead as a man's- "non standard" as it may be. You may in the future have the option of medically transitioning and if you'd so like, can save up for top surgery and, if desired, bottom surgery.

    I have pretty bad bottom dysphoria myself so I can't say I know perfectly how to cope.
